If the
pc was new and had only Vista installed (ie not an upgrade from XP) you should have a recovery disk to bring it back. I would try powering off for 30 mins first and then try firing it up again. Othrewise, find the install disk put it into the drive and reboot. Good luck
Ken, are you sure it’s a Vista problem? You should be able to boot from a DVD and get the mouse and keyboard. This sounds like it could be a hardware problem. It is possible CMOS was shorted as part of the uncontrolled shutdown and your BIOS has reverted to factory. In that case, you must buy (or borrow) a very cheap non-USB keyboard or buy a USB-to-serial keyboard adapter. Boot the PC, go into hardware setup, and look around the system setup. There will be an option to support USB keyboard. Make sure it's checked. Save the settings. The machine should reboot automatically--do NOT let windows start. Turn off the computer, then cold boot the PC.
Go back into hardware setup and make sure the USB keyboard is still in the state you changed it to. If it isn't, your machine is shutting down because your CMOS is shorting, or, more likely, your CMOS battery is bad. In that case go to Wal-Mart and buy a new one. CMOS batteries are usually photo C2036, I think, but pull it out and take it along.
Once you get USB keyboard settings in BIOS to stick where you left them, cold boot with the USB keyboard and see if the machine recognizes your hardware.
